South Korea plans to deliver the second batch of coal on the "Hasan-Radzhin" branch from Yakutia
To test the capacities of the Russian-North Korean project "Khasan-Rajin" South Korea intends to re-purchase and deliver Russian coal along the line "Khasan-Rajin," RG writes.
This time the party will be twice as large as in November last yearwhen the POSCO concern bought 40500 tons of coal from Kuzbass for their needs. The exporting mines will also change, this time they will be Yakut Elga or Neryungri.
Russian officials told RG that the expected delivery date is the end of April.
